Nphpmailer attachment pdf example product

Phpmailer can be downloaded from pdf to flip book converter the official site. In the comcast case the pdf was inserted in the body of the email as code preceded by. Written by saran on january 8, 2011, updated september 24, 2018. What would be the best approach as i have tried using php mail but i keep getting the following message warning. In general, people can directly read the pdf file by clicking attached pdf file, right. It is possible to send files as attachments with mass emails. Closed rishijash opened this issue mar 28, 2016 9 comments closed addattachment not working with. Mail merge by email with pdf attachment i have a spreadsheet of over 300 contacts who i need to email a pdf attachment to. Multiple email attachments and upload script tutorial depot. So, today lets findout how we can send email with an attachment using php mail.

I am well versed in mail merging, and am aware that you cannot merge with an attachment in word, but wondered if there is the ability to do this. Smtp pdf attachment can someone clue me in on how attachments work in smtp. So, without any more introduction, heres a php script that sends a mail message with an attachment. May 09, 2014 hello edsel, you might have noticed that in the method code, it is splitting the character content string by the separator give as input, so you have to prepare this special content separated by the separator and then pass that internal table as the input while calling the method and to prepare this you will have to loop in the itab and then use concatenate statement. The documentation provides an overview of the complete product range, including getting started tutorials, technical articles and reference guides. But my client said they cannot open and read pdf on email. While i am able to send the email properly, i am not able. Sometimes, according to a special circumstance, also would be valuable to send directly the pdf as attachment e. If you do not want to use a filename, set this value as false, otherwise a filename is generated automatically. The most concise screencasts for the working developer, updated daily.

Im trying to send an email with a pdf attachment using php. Can someone clue me in on how attachments work in smtp. Sometimes we may need to send email from our website to the client with some attachment. All of samples in this section are based on first section. File attachment and phpmailer class php the sitepoint forums. Is this possible to do or what would be my best approach. In this tutorial we will query the mysql database to get the updated data from our table and email the data to the desired email as pdf attachment. Attachment is a pdf file, it is under homemyusersample. Note, the tutorial is a little bit quick and dirty and should work on a linux web server i did a test on my local ubuntu box. But they can open it after they download it to computer. I would like to send email with file attached using html form and phpmailer class. File attachment and phpmailer class php the sitepoint. Send email with pdf attachment using php solutions experts. Send email with pdf attachment using php solutions.

I could just create a regular visual force page and render as pdf i know but wondering if i can salvage the emailtemplate in any way and send it as an attachment. Aug 06, 2019 our example script helps web developers to send text or html email including any types of files like image. Send pdf via email, send email with pdf attachment pdf. To compile and run the following example codes successfully, please click here to learn how to create the test project and add reference of easendmail to your project. The mass email feature in allows users to use an email template to send an email to up to 250 recipients at once. I am having problems understanding how to email an attachment using. Sample code to illustrate how easy it is to sent the contents of a tx text control via email as a pdf attachment.

To send an email with file attachment, we need to use addattachment method. Unable to download pdf file attachments from emails. You probably know how to send email with php, its just few lines of code, but it gets bit tricky when you want to send an attachment with php email. Aug 30, 2014 however, i was looking for an example where the user attaches a file with an email form as shown in my 1st post and the email with the file attached is sent to the receiver. It is based on fpdf and html2fpdf, with a number of enhancements.

You can either send it as an attachment, which is the logical method, or you can extract the content from the pdf and use that as the email body. Send email with multiple attachments in php codexworld. You can configure an emailoutput node to send an email with a single attachment. If the file attachment size is within the specified size limit then try the steps below. In the following example, we will create an attachment for a picture. How to attach pdf to html email template for mass emails. My mail got sent but the attachment isnt visible in the mail. To send an email with multiple attachments, see producing dynamic email messages use the websphere message broker toolkit to configure the properties on the emailoutput node so that you can send an email with a statically defined subject and text, and an attachment, to a statically defined list of recipients.

The attachment file has to be uploaded first or you can use a file which already exists on your web server. Adobe reader could not open because either it is not a supported file type or the file has been damaged for example it was sent as an email. The pdf files can be opened in a variety of programs on both pc and mac systems, including adobes acrobat reader and apples. We will then attach the picture to the email and send it. Hi all, i have written code for sending mail with pdf file as attachment, but mail sending is not working. May 23, 20 in this post you will learn how to send mail with attachments in php. I write arbitrary there because a lot of the example php mail scripts ive seen focus on attaching an image, and im not really familiar with mime types yet, and imagejpg wasnt working for my needs. This documentation applies to nodemailer version v2. How can i send pdf file as body of email, not as attachment. If you have adobe acrobat and msoffice 2010, for example, you should be able to right click an email and convert it to pdf, with all attachments being attached to the pdf by default. Dec 11, 2017 i have tried sending a mail content along with a pdf attachment. How to convert email and attachments to one pdf document. Apr 03, 2020 but sometimes email functionality needs to be extended for sending an attachment with the mail. I need to be able to download attachments etc from e mails by download, do you mean open to view, orsaveto your hard disk.

This method can attach a file to the email message from local disk or a remote url. On a good day this would end our journey because this is exactly how emojis in attachment filenames are supposed to work. In this tutorial, we will show you how to send email with attachment in php. In the example script, we will make it simple to send text or html email including any types of files as an attachment like image. The email class used in this tutorial is using the native php mail function. Our example script helps web developers to send text or html email including any types of files like image. I want to know that when we email others with pdf attachment. Restart the computer in clean boot mode and check if outlook is able to send the pdf attachment. Php mail attachment script this custom function or php mail attachment script is able to send a plain text email message together with a single attachment file.

You can send attachments using a multipartmixed content header. Send email with pdf attachment using php angularcode. Browse other questions tagged php email pdf attachment phpmailer or ask your own question. The email with attachments came through fine in yahoo, gmail and a pop server, but was corrupt when sent to a address. In this post you will learn how to send mail with attachments in php. I have a custom visualforce email template and want to email it but as an attachment. Adobe reader could not open because either it is not a supported file type or the file has been damaged for example it was sent as an email attachment and wasnt correctly decoded. Sending htmlphp form data in mail with attachment using. Or select the email, select adobe pdf menu in outlook and click on convert selected messages. Our example code makes the whole process simple and you can send email with multiple attachments by calling a single function.

I have tried sending a mail content along with a pdf attachment. Here is an example of a message with a pdf attachment, a text body and. Attachment object consists of the following properties. Hello edsel, you might have noticed that in the method code, it is splitting the character content string by the separator give as input, so you have to prepare this special content separated by the separator and then pass that internal table as the input while calling the method and to prepare this you will have to loop in the itab and then use concatenate. Mail merge by email with pdf attachment microsoft community. Feb 16, 2010 ensure the file attachment size is not larger than the size limit allowed by your internet service provider isp. Oct 09, 2019 sometimes we may need to send email from our website to the client with some attachment. But sometimes email functionality needs to be extended for sending an attachment with the mail. Lets send a message with an attachment name formatted this way to for example an email address hosted by qq, a huge chinese email provider. I tried to add code like that at other places as well mimemsg. Send pdf file as attachment in email php the sitepoint. If you meant cannot open pdf attachment, you need to have adobe reader to open pdf files. These docs apply to the unmaintained versions of nodemailer v2 and older. Portable document format, or pdf for short, was established so that entire documents could be transported over the internet in their entirety and not as individual pages.

1250 540 1336 366 825 766 123 1001 1006 1231 730 1312 1498 385 730 1037 1227 585 1366 1002 1099 352 1218 1533 612 1105 587 1519 131 1013 58 753 1081 1105 1331 545 1043 976 219 385 519 1447 133 657 282